Challenges Facing the Horse Sport Industry: Horse Sport Ireland (Resumed)

Mr. Michael Dowling:

There are nine members on the board - four appointed by the Minister, four from industry and one from Northern Ireland. The consultation paper set out a way we could broaden the constituency from which we would draw new industry members. Obviously, the affiliates have a variety of views on that. We are in the process of meeting them and listening to their views. We met five of the affiliates jointly within the last month. They are to come back with a more formal position on their suggestions. There are three or four other affiliates who have given views on the consultation document and we are in the process of setting up meetings with them. I would envisage that those meetings will take place within the next week or two. After that, we have to sit down and take account of their views, as well as the views we set out in the document. What we are trying to do is to get a broader range of people to come on to the board, taking account of the fact that we need greater diversity and that we also have to have gender balance. The old system of appointing people to the board was not necessarily capable of giving us the gender balance. It will be a couple of months before we will be in a position to move forward on the appointments.
